INTENSIVE CARE UNITS

opor

The Intensive Care Unit (ICU) is an essential pillar of modern tertiary healthcare. Critical illness represents a state in which life cannot be sustained without advanced, often invasive, therapeutic interventions. At Shri Ramkrishna Institute of Medical Sciences & Sanaka Hospitals, our Critical Care Services are designed to provide comprehensive, round-the-clock support to patients requiring intensive monitoring and life-saving treatment.


Comprehensive Critical Care Services

Our hospital houses multiple specialized intensive care units, including:

  • Medical ICU (MICU) and Cardiac Care Unit
  • Surgical ICU (SICU)
  • Neonatal Intensive Care Unit (NICU)
  • Pediatric Intensive Care Unit (PICU)

Each unit is staffed with dedicated intensivists, specialist consultants, and trained critical care nursing personnel, ensuring 24×7 medical supervision and optimal nurse-to-patient ratios.


Advanced Monitoring & Life Support Infrastructure

All Critical Care Units are equipped with state-of-the-art facilities, including:

  • Continuous multi-parameter monitoring systems
  • Invasive and non-invasive hemodynamic monitoring (NIBP & IBP)
  • Invasive and non-invasive ventilators
  • BiPAP / CPAP ventilatory support systems
  • Mainstream EtCO₂ monitoring
  • Volumetric infusion pumps and syringe pumps
  • Dialysis support for critically ill patients
  • External pacemaker (pulse generator)
  • Biphasic defibrillators

This comprehensive infrastructure enables management of complex medical, surgical, cardiac, neonatal, and pediatric emergencies.


Specialized Units

Medical, Cardiac & Surgical ICUs:
Medical, Cardiac & Surgical ICUs

Designed for the management of severe infections, organ failure, post-operative care, trauma, and other life-threatening conditions requiring continuous advanced support. Cardiac critical care is dedicated to patients with acute cardiac emergencies, including myocardial infarction, arrhythmias, and heart failure, supported by advanced cardiac monitoring and pacing facilities.

NICU & PICU:
NICU & PICU

Our Neonatal and Pediatric Intensive Care Units provide specialized care for critically ill newborns and children, ensuring age-appropriate monitoring, respiratory support, and life-saving interventions.
